Teenager Suffers Serious Head Injury in Blackburn Off-Road Bike Collision

Published by Robert L Senior Reporter on Wednesday 9th April 2025 at 07:10hrs


Police are appealing for witnesses and footage following a serious collision in Blackburn yesterday evening.

Emergency services were called to Quarry Street at 6:24 pm on Tuesday, April 8, following reports of a collision.

Officers attending the scene found that an off-road crosser bike, travelling on Quarry Street in the direction of Manner Sutton Street, had collided with a steel shutter on a building.

The rider of the bike, a 16-year-old boy, sustained a serious head injury as a result of the incident. He was immediately taken to hospital, where he remains for treatment.

Lancashire Police have expressed their concern for the injured teenager, stating, “Our thoughts are with him as he undergoes treatment in hospital.”

As part of their investigation into the circumstances of the collision, police are urging anyone who witnessed the incident or who may have relevant dashcam or CCTV footage from the Quarry Street area around 6:24 pm on Tuesday to come forward.

Anyone with information is asked to call 101, quoting log number 1125 of April 8th.
